Bath Street (Charing Cross), King's Theatre, 335 Bath Street Five Profile Portrait Medallions, Heraldic Lion and Associated Decorative Carving (1903-4) Sculptor: unknown; Architect: F Matcham; Builders: Morrison & Mason Ltd | 1 top |
Calder Street (Govanhill), Calder Street Public Baths and Wash-house, 99 Calder Street Bronze Inscription Plaque with Medallion Portrait (1914) Sculptor: unknown; Foundry: Elkington & Co Ltd | 2 top |
Cranworth Street (Hillhead), Western Baths, 8-12 Cranworth Street Two Female Heads (1876-81) Sculptor: unknown; Architect: Clarke & Bell | 3 top |
